当前位置:首页 » 编程语言 » sql读取不到数据
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sql读取不到数据

发布时间: 2023-04-25 07:50:19

❶ 为什么sqlserver查询不到数据

查不到数据可以从以下方面入手
首先检查语句是否发生错误,有异常就无法查询,所以没数据
接下来检查表,表中是否存在数据,表内没数据,查询自然没数据
再检查SQL条件,是否因为条件的原因,造成没有数据。
最后一个可能,你连接错数据库

❷ asp从access升级到sql后读取不到数据

session("user_id")=clng(rs("user_id"))
先去掉clng看看洞掘rs("user_id")的真实类容,估计是user_id字历正段类型的问纳烂核题,经过clng转换出问题了

❸ 通过Excel导入到SQL数据库的数据,使用软件无法读取

打开sql,按图中的路径进入导入数据界面。
2
导入的时候需要将EXCEL的文件准备好,不能打开。点击下一步。
3
数据源:选择“Microsoft
Excel”除了EXCEL类型的数据,sql还支持很多其它数据源类型。
4
选择需要导入的EXCEL文件。点击浏览,找到导入的文件确定。
5
默认为是使用的windows身份验证,改为穗手昌使用sql身份验证。输入数据库密码,注意:数据库,这里看看是不是导入的数据库。也可以在这里临时改变,选择其它数据库。
6
选择导入数据EXCEL表内容范围,若有几个SHEET表,或一个SHEET表中有些数据不想导入,则可以编写查询指定的数据进行导入。点击下一步。
7
选择需要导入猜扒的表,比如在这里将表名改为price,则导入后生面的sql数据库表为price$。点击进入下一步。到达下一步后,再次点击下一步。
8
在这里完整显示了导入的信息,执行内容,再次确认无误后,点击完成,开始执行。
9
执行成功:可以看看执行结果,已传输多少行,表示从excel表中导入多少条数据,包括列名标题。这样就完成了,执行sql查询语句:薯凯SELECT
*
FROM
price$就可以查看已导入的数据内容.

❹ sql server management数据库连接成功了查询语句也正确但是查不到数据

应该是你的connectionstring格谈含宏式不对,你再查一下,找找用来连接sql server数据库的字符串模板,对比一下…不同类型的数含册据库,格式不一样的吧,网上找了个参考:
"Data Source=bds2715212581.my3w.com;Initial Catalog=bds271521258_db;Persist Security Info=True;User ID=bds271521258;Password=123456"老手

❺ SQL 2005的数据无法正常显示和读取

应该是瞎碧如你的SQL字符集配置问题,你是慧坦否修改了SQL字符集?
如果是的话,磨启请按下操作:
alter datebase 数据库 COLLATE chinese_prc_ci_as
如果还显示乱码,就重启一下数据库。

❻ SQL读取数据异常

String sql="select * from topic where ID="+Integer.parseInt(ID)+""仿穗燃;

在最后面加个分号备虚试试?

分都不给一点,回答难啊族派!

❼ 帮忙看看这条SQL语句 为什么查不出来数据,明明数据库里有数据但就是查不出来

照你上边的原文:有几个地方是存在点问题洞清世。
1、where expect='"&qihao&"' and ' and 之前应该有空格。
2、protype like 'fsd' ' 如果fsd是个变量,则正猜应写成 protype like '%"&fsd&"%'
3、rs.open sql,conn,1,1 ' 这么纳肢写更好一些。
其它没发现什么。

❽ 数据库中有此条数据,但是用sql查不出来

项目中遇见的问题

存储的联系人2200多条。每次根据机构级别 ol 来查询的。

select * from ADRESS_BOOK_USER where ol>=9    

ol  小于10的都可以查出来,但是 大于10的就是查不出来,

sql 写的也卖慧没有问题,就是查不出数据。

经仔细审查,原来存表的时候数据结构给写错了。

ol 应该用int 类型,当初存滑搜成了字符串类型。症结问题中让答就在此。

以后,不要闲麻烦, 数据类型一定要精确,否则给后来的查询埋炕。

最后将sql 语句修改一下,select * from ADRESS_BOOK_USER where ol+0>=9  就可以查出来了。

ol+0  ➕0 代表将字符串强转为int 类型。

❾ mysql读不到数据库里的数据

mysql读取不到数据库
1.
mysql服务没启动;
2.
sock文件路径设置错误 ;
3.
sock文件所在碧链目录的权限问题;
4.
这个文件直接丢失了 解决步骤: 1)检查服务有没有启动mysql.sock文件,如果该路径下没有sock文件,我们先用find命令找出这个文件的位置,如果find也找不到,重启一下mysql服务即可,会自动生成一个。 我们前纳就可以这样创建: ln -s /var/lib/mysql.sock /tmp/mysql.sock ,创建完之后,再尝试连接 另外需悔悔孙要注意的是,mysql.sock文件默认是在/tmp下,数据库启动的时候 16320 读取不到项目内的资源
查看更多

❿ 为什么这段sql语句查询不出数据

一般查询不出就是不等于某值时没有数据,并不一定代表语句错误。

在SQL语句中不等于有两种用法,一种是"<>",一种是"!="(均不含引号)。

1、创建测试表,插入数据:


createtabletest(idint,namevarchar(10));insertintotestvalues(1,'张三');insertintotestvalues(2,'李四');

2、执行第一种操作"<>"


select*fromtestwhereid<>1;

结果如图: